The Jewish Educational Loan Fund

The Jewish Educational Loan Fund – JELF is an interest-free loan that covers college educational and living expenses often overlooked by traditional financial aid, including travel, rent, food, and books. By offering 0% interest loans, JELF saves borrowers thousands of dollars annually, alleviating the burden of high-interest student loan debt.  JELF application submission are beginning January 1 and ends April 30.  Please visit the JELF website at www.jelf.org https://www.alpertjfs.org/the-jewish-educational-loan-fund/
